Recruitment Admin Associate Manager is responsible for administration of a medium to large recruiting demand plan. The individual will be responsible to deliver outsourced recruitment services for designated clients within agreed timeframes for job posting, sourcing candidates against active and proactive demands (through job portals, professional sites, networking, head hunting, employee references, job adverts), building talent communities, screening, engaging with candidates, scheduling interviews, administering online assessments where needed, assisting with reference checks and back ground verification checks, facilitating vendor invoicing and tracking candidates on ATS as per company standards.
